  • Question
    Do I have to keep the father of the pups separate from them?
    Community Answer
    The father should not mind the pups. If he shows aggression, yes, keep him away, but mom, dad, and babies should be fine together. After a few weeks, you'll notice that mom and dad both get super sick of the pups. This is normal, but they should not be aggressive.

  • Question
    My 4.5lb Chihuahua is in heat and will be mating with another small Chihuahua in a couple of days. When she's due to have her pups, is it necessary for the vet to deliver or could I deliver on my own?
    Community Answer
    In principle, your dog can deliver her puppies on her own. However, if it is her first litter of puppies or earlier deliveries did not go well, you should call a vet a few days before your pup is going to deliver (which is most of the time about 62 days after mating) and ask the vet for advice. Also, if you think anything is going wrong or you are just not sure, keep your vet on speed dial! Pregnancy and delivery can be dangerous for both your dog and her puppies so make sure you are safe!
  • Question
    How long will the chihuahua pups nurse on the mother?
    Community Answer
    They usually can start to be weaned at 4 weeks of age. They can usually be completely weaned at 8 weeks. This time can vary.
  • Question
    Should I still walk my chihuahua on warmer days during the summer?
    Community Answer
    Try not to walk her too much as she will need to rest, but a short walk once a day wouldn't hurt. Just make sure to bring water in case she needs it. Also, check to see that the pavement isn't too hot before you take her out.
